The convening will bring together international economists, AI research organisations, global institutions, think tanks, and delegates from countries attending the AI Impact Summit 2026. As governments develop AI workforce transition strategies, access to local AI usage data is increasingly important. The event will examine why such data matters, what level of granularity is needed, and why countries must have reliable access to it.
